How much does a Licensed Vocational Nurse make in DeSoto, TX?

The average salary for a Licensed Vocational Nurse is $59,370 per year in DeSoto, TX.

A Licensed Vocational Nurse in DeSoto, TX can expect to earn a competitive salary. On average, these professionals make about $59,370 each year. This figure can vary based on factors such as experience, education, and workplace. Some nurses may earn more, while others may earn less, but most will fall within this range.


The salary data shows a clear trend. The most common salary range falls between $52,909 and $60,727 per year. Nearly half of all nurses in this area earn within this range. Nurses who have more experience or specialized skills might earn more, while those just starting out may earn less. Still, the average remains a solid benchmark for what to expect in the field.

What are the highest paying cities for a Licensed Vocational Nurse near DeSoto, TX?

Licensed Vocational Nurses in Seagoville, TX, can expect to earn the highest average salary near DeSoto, TX. Seagoville offers an average salary of $80,132, making it a top choice for those seeking higher pay. Candidates should consider the job opportunities and salary potential in this area.
Graph displaying highest paying cities salaries for Licensed Vocational Nurse jobs near DeSoto, TX, highlighting Seagoville, TX with the highest at $80,132 and Dallas, TX with the lowest at $58,952.
